PayPal Holdings (PYPL)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$1.34, surpassing the consensus estimate of $1.2929 by 3.64%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the preliminary report, but the earnings beat underscored improved cost control and operational efficiency. Following the announcement, PYPL shares rose 1.6%, reflecting cautious investor optimism around the company’s profitability trajectory.

PayPal’s Q1 2026 earnings beat was driven by a continued focus on expense discipline and margin enhancement. While total payment volume growth may have moderated amid persistent macroeconomic headwinds, the company appears to have benefited from its ongoing transformation initiatives, including the migration to higher-margin branded checkout products and the expansion of its Venmo monetization efforts. Transaction expense leverage likely improved, contributing to the above-consensus EPS. PayPal’s take rate trends may have stabilized as the mix shifts toward more profitable segments such as PayPal Checkout and unbranded processing. Additionally, the company’s active account base remained relatively stable, though engagement metrics—such as transactions per active account—could have seen modest gains. Management has been prioritizing operating leverage through headcount rationalization and automation, which may have supported the bottom line despite an uncertain revenue environment. The absence of revenue details in the release leaves some ambiguity regarding top-line momentum, but the EPS surprise suggests that cost efficiencies are materializing ahead of expectations.

PayPal did not provide explicit forward guidance in this preliminary Q1 2026 report, but management may update its full-year outlook during the earnings call. The company has previously targeted mid-single-digit revenue growth for fiscal 2026, though currency headwinds and consumer spending softness could pose risks. Strategic priorities continue to include deepening partnerships with major e-commerce platforms, enhancing one-click checkout capabilities, and expanding into offline payments via card-present solutions. The company also anticipates further margin expansion from its cost-reduction program, targeting non-GAAP operating margin improvement of 100–150 basis points for the year. However, competitive pressure from rivals such as Apple Pay and Block’s Square may limit share gains. Regulatory risks around digital payments and data privacy remain a watchpoint, particularly in Europe and the U.S. PayPal’s ability to sustain earnings momentum may hinge on execution in its branded product lines and the pace of innovation in its small-business lending and buy now, pay later offerings.

The 1.6% stock move following the Q1 beat reflects a tempered reaction, as investors weigh the EPS upside against the uncertainty around revenue trends. Analysts may view this quarter as a confirmation that PayPal’s cost restructuring is on track, but likely will seek greater clarity on top-line growth drivers before adjusting price targets. Some analysts may raise estimates slightly due to the earnings surprise, while others could remain cautious given the competitive landscape and potential consumer spending deceleration. Key areas to watch in the coming quarters include transaction margin trends, active account growth (or stabilization), and any updates to the company’s share buyback program. The market may also be looking for signs that new product launches—such as the PayPal Advance Card or enhanced merchant tools—can reaccelerate payment volume. Overall, the quarter suggests PayPal is achieving near-term profitability goals, but sustained investor confidence may require evidence of durable revenue expansion.
